WRIGHTSVILLE BEACH, N.C. — A Coast Guard boat crew recovered the body of a 68-year-old man from the Wrightsville Beach Channel on Monday. 

The Coast Guard said Marine Max Boat Sales called to report that a man had piloted the boat through the channel with an apparent injury. When Station Wrightsville Beach boat crews launched to investigate, the man fell from his boat into the water. 

Crews tried to resuscitate the man, until EMS arrived and declared him dead. 

The man's name was not released. 

The Coast Guard and North Carolina Wildlife Resource Commission members are investigating the cause of the incident.
